One of the first and most influential giallo films, Mario Bava 1964’s visual treat centers on the Cristiana Haute Couture fashion house, where models and their boyfriends excel at the art of backstabbing, blackmail, and snorting cocaine. That is, until a faceless maniac embarks on a mission of death.
Combining elements of contemporary West German murder mystery films with the lurid juxtaposition of eroticism and violence from popular pulp novels at the time, Bava created a new sub-genre that would soon take the world by storm. With a score from the prolific Carlo Rustichelli and vivid technicolor shots from Ubaldo Terzano, the result is a glorious, yet disturbing piece of pop art trash.
Screened in Italian with English subtitles.
